PSCC Students! Pace yourself with your Service-Learning assignment so you don't fall behind
In this episode, I speak directly to students about how to get started with their Service-Learning assignment. I walk through several important parts of getting started with your assignment and I remind students how important it is to stay on track and pace their progress with this assignment. It is really hard if you procrastinate when doing Service-Learning because you have to connect with a community agency and you have to schedule your service hours around their needs based on your assignment details for your course.
